Do Flowers Really Talk, or Is It Just the Florist’s Heart?

As a florist, I often find myself wondering: do flowers really talk, or is it just my imagination? When I'm arranging a bouquet, it feels as though each flower has its own voice, its own story to tell. I hear their whispers as I carefully place each bloom, guiding me on how they wish to be arranged. For me, it's more than just a job—it's an art form, a heartfelt conversation with nature. When I touch a rose, its velvety petals against my skin feel like a promise of love and beauty. I can't help but gently kiss the blossoms as if to reassure them that they're safe and cherished. It might sound playful, but I like to think that these little gestures of affection help the flowers shine brighter.

Before each bouquet leaves my hands, I silently pray that it finds a home where its beauty will be truly appreciated. I want people to see the elegance of each stem, the gentleness of every petal, and feel the joy that I feel when arranging them.

There is something profoundly moving about watching someone receive flowers. The moment their face lights up, it’s as if the flowers and their emotions speak to one another. It's one of the most rewarding parts of being a florist—witnessing that instant of happiness, of connection.

Flowers are more than just gifts; they're a way of expressing love, gratitude, celebration, or sympathy without the need for words. They have this magical ability to bring a smile, even in the toughest of times. But not every bouquet I make is handed directly to a recipient. Sometimes, I have to hand over these carefully crafted arrangements to a courier or leave them quietly on a doorstep. These are the moments that tug at my heartstrings. I always wonder about the reaction on the other side of the door. Did the flowers bring a smile? Did they light up someone's day? I find myself wishing I could collect all these unseen smiles and display them in a gallery—each smile a testament to the joy flowers bring to our lives.

Flowers may not literally speak, but through the love and care I pour into every arrangement, I hope they convey a message that words alone sometimes cannot. To me, every petal, every bloom, whispers kindness, joy, and love. And as a florist, I feel truly blessed to be a part of that silent, yet profound, conversation.
